    70% of the channels of the Max application are state-created.

    20 February 2026
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Email VKontakte Telegram WhatsApp Copy Link
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Email Copy Link

    Out of the approximately 170,000 channels existing in the national messaging app Max, about 70% — that is, 118,200 — were created by state structures, according to the publication “Agenstvo”. The majority, 116,600 pages, use the suffix _gos in their names, assigned to public institutions through the “Platform for Partners”, according to the instructions of the Russian Ministry of Digital Development. At least another 1,000 state-owned blogs do not use this suffix.

    Through the same platform, initially intended for the business environment, 22,200 channels with the suffix _biz were registered. Of these, over 500 also belong to state structures. Approximately 80 other blogs are managed by the “United Russia” party, and 46 — by LDPR.

    Out of the 118,000 state channels, at least 70,000 were created by municipal authorities and public institutions. Over 34,000 pages belong to schools, high schools and gymnasiums, about 19,000 — to kindergartens, over 5,000 — to local administrations. Another 2,400 channels are registered by universities and colleges, approximately 1,000 — by medical institutions and about 800 — by libraries.
